Abstract
A system, method, and apparatus for palletizing cargo on a rack for shipment are provided. The system generally includes a tiered rack having a base tier, a support framework extending from the base tier, and a second tier adjustably attached to the support framework. The system may further include a plurality of lower frame support members positioned longitudinally across the bottom of the base tier, and a plurality of pneumatically actuated rollers spaced to cooperatively engage the plurality of lower frame support members, the rollers being selectively extendable from a plurality of raised tracks positioned longitudinally along a floor of the railcar, where the rollers are configured to pneumatically extend past an upper surface of the track when actuated and allow for linear motion there over.

6. A method for bulk loading a railcar without a forklift entering the railcar, comprising:
-
bulk loading a multi-tiered rack with cargo; transporting the loaded multi-tiered rack through a loading opening of a railcar with a forklift; positioning the loaded multi-tiered rack onto a plurality of raised tracks positioned on a floor of the railcar with the forklift, while supporting wheels of the forklift remain outside of the railcar; moving the loaded multi-tiered rack from a position proximate the loading opening to a position within the railcar, the moving being conducted on a plurality of pneumatically extendable rollers extending from the plurality of raised tracks; and securing the loaded multi-tiered rack in the railcar by retracting the extendable rollers to allow the loaded rack to rest on the raised tracks. - View Dependent Claims (7, 8, 9, 10)

11. In combination with a railcar, an adjustable rack for supporting multiple tiers of cargo in the railcar, comprising:
-
a rigid structurally supporting base member having fork pockets on a side thereof; an upright support framework extending upward from the base member; a second tier adjustably attached to the support framework above the base member; an air permeable cargo support member positioned to cover an upper surface of the second tier and an upper surface of the base member; an air permeable theft prevention layer attached to the support framework on at least the first or second sides of the rack and substantially covering a surface of each of the first and second sides; and a plurality of structural members positioned on a lower side of the base member and configured to engage a corresponding number of rollers positioned on a floor of the railcar. - View Dependent Claims (12)
